dc.description.abstractIn this paper, the ant system algorithm is modified and used for localization of partial discharge (PD) source location in a power transformer. General localization assumes that EM wave propagates along the line of sight. However, EM wave in a power transformer randomly scattered due to internal structures of a power transformer. Therefore, a general ant system algorithm often used to solve TSP problem needs to be modified in order to calculate the shortest path and to reduce error of TDoA localization. By using the proposed modified ant algorithm, the accuracy of TDoA localization is improved from 16.86mm to 1.58mm.-
